Wood fence installation involves constructing a durable barrier made from natural wood materials to enclose or define outdoor spaces. This service typically includes selecting appropriate fencing styles, preparing the property, and properly installing the fence posts, panels, and hardware to ensure stability and longevity. Skilled contractors focus on creating a secure and aesthetically pleasing enclosure that can enhance privacy, mark property boundaries, or add decorative appeal to a yard or garden.
Homeowners often turn to wood fencing to address common issues such as unwanted intrusions, noise reduction, or lack of privacy. A well-installed wood fence can help keep children and pets safely within the yard while preventing strangers or animals from entering. Additionally, it can serve as a visual barrier, reducing street noise and creating a more secluded outdoor environment. Many property owners also choose wood fencing to improve curb appeal and increase the overall value of their home.
This type of fencing is popular for residential properties, including single-family homes, cottages, and estates. It is also frequently used in rural settings or properties with large yards where a natural, classic look is desired. Wood fences are versatile and customizable, allowing homeowners to select different styles, heights, and finishes that match their property’s aesthetic and functional needs. The overview below groups typical Wood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or fence repairs or short sections typ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for simple fixes or small sections of fencing.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.
Basic Fence Installation - installing a new wood fence for a standard-sized yard us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Most projects of this type fall into this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for added features or larger areas.
Full Fence Replacement - replacing an existing fence or installing a fence over a large property can range from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ger, more intricate projects or premium materials can push costs beyond this range, but many projects stay within the typical upper-middle tier.
Custom or High-End Projects - highly customized or elaborate wood fencing projects can cost $7,000 and above. These tend to be less common, with many local contractors handling standard installations within lower to mid-range budgets.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ood are commonly used for fence installation? Local contractors typically work with a variety of woods such as c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different durability and aesthetic options.
How long does a wood fence installation usually take? The duration depends on the size of the project and site conditions; local service providers can provide estimates based on specific requirements.
What preparation is needed before installing a wood fence? Preparation often involves clearing the area, marking the fence line, and ensuring the ground is level; local pros can advise on site-specific steps.
Are there different styles of wood fences available? Yes, options include privacy fences, picket fences, and ranch rail fences, among others, with local contractors able to recommend suitable styles.
What maintenance is required for a wood fence? Regular staining, sealing, and inspections are recommended to maintain appearance and longevity; local service providers can offer maintenance advice.
